Bilirubin is recognized as an endogenous antioxidant, and low serum bilirubin is reported to be associated with the progression of kidney disease. However, it is unclear whether serum bilirubin levels are associated with the loss of residual kidney function (RKF) in peritoneal dialysis (PD) patients. This study investigated the relationship between serum total bilirubin and loss of RKF. We prospectively followed 94 PD patients who started PD in our hospital between June 2006 and May 2016. Ten patients who had chronic liver disease or cirrhosis were excluded. Patients were divided into three groups based on serum total bilirubin concentration tertiles: tertile 1 (T1) < 0.3, T2 = 0.3, and T3 ≥ 0.4 mg/dL. We estimated the relationship between serum bilirubin and loss of RKF, defined as daily urine volume (<100 mL) within 3 years after starting PD, using a Cox proportional hazards model. During the 3‐year observation period, 22 patients lost RKF. The incidence rate of loss of RKF increased linearly with the decrease in serum total bilirubin levels (P for trend < 0.05). After adjusting for confounding factors, low serum total bilirubin level was shown to be an independent predictor of loss of RKF (hazard ratio [HR] for every 0.1 mg/dL decrease, 1.50; 95% confidence interval [CI], 1.01–2.51; HR [95%CI] for T2 and T1 [vs. T3] 2.03 [0.65–7.88] and 3.70 [1.00–15.9]). This study suggests that low serum total bilirubin levels are associated with the loss of RKF in PD patients.  相似文献

Hepcidin's relationships with other variables are unclear. We evaluated associations of serum hepcidin with clinical parameters in ESRD patients. Ninety‐nine incident dialysis patients, including 57 on peritoneal dialysis (PD) and 42 on HD, were prospectively followed for 6 months. Serum hepcidin levels significantly increased during initial 6 months of dialysis. In the multivariate regression model, independent predictors of serum hepcidin levels in ESRD patients before maintenance dialysis were interleukin‐6, ferritin, phosphate, iron, and aspartate transaminase. Six months after initiating dialysis, serum hepcidin levels were independently predicted by ferritin, total iron binding capacity (TIBC), and aspartate transaminase in all patients, whereas by ferritin and TIBC in PD patients, and ferritin, TIBC, and 24‐h urine volume in HD patients. Serum hepcidin levels are differentially associated with anemia parameters in PD compared with HD patients. Urine volume was an independent predictor of hepcidin levels in early HD patients.  相似文献

Peritoneal protein loss due to high peritoneal permeability may contribute to hypoalbuminemia and early withdrawal from peritoneal dialysis (PD) therapy in end stage renal disease (ESRD) patients. We have found that pigment epithelium‐derived factor (PEDF) has anti‐vasopermeability properties both in cell culture and animal models by counteracting the biological actions of vascular endothelial growth factor (VEGF). However, it remains unknown which clinical variables, including dialysate VEGF and PEDF, are associated with decreased serum albumin levels and could predict early withdrawal from the PD in ESRD patients. We address these issues. Twenty‐seven ESRD patients undergoing PD were enrolled. Clinical variables were measured at 6 months after commencing PD. We examined the independent correlates of serum albumin in PD patients and then prospectively investigated the predictors of withdrawal from the PD therapy over 4 years. Dialysate VEGF was associated with peritoneal solute transport rate (P = 0.002), serum albumin (inversely, P < 0.001) and dialysate PEDF levels (P < 0.001). In multiple stepwise regression analysis, age (P = 0.002) and dialysate VEGF levels (P < 0.001) were independent determinants of serum albumin levels. High VEGF (>27 pg/mL), low serum albumin (≤3.31 g/dL) and low hemoglobin (≤11.2 g/dL) were correlated with withdrawal from the PD therapy during the 4 years. The odds ratio of dialysate VEGF for early withdrawal from the PD was 6.310 (P = 0.035). The present study demonstrated that increased dialysate VEGF was associated with decreased serum albumin and early withdrawal from the PD therapy. Inhibition of peritoneal VEGF production may be a therapeutic target in PD patients.  相似文献

Peritonitis remains an important cause of morbidity and mortality in peritoneal dialysis (PD) patients, but its incidence and the distribution of causative organisms vary widely between institutions and age groups. This study was performed to investigate the recent status and risk factors of PD‐related peritonitis and to clarify differences between age groups. We retrospectively reviewed the medical records of 119 PD patients treated at our department between January 2002 and January 2013. We calculated both overall and organism‐specific peritonitis rates and also analyzed risk factors. Sixty‐three episodes of peritonitis occurred during 261.5 patient‐years for an incident rate of 0.24 episodes/patient‐year. Multivariate analysis showed that older age (≥65 years) and hypoalbuminemia (<3.0 g/dL) were associated with an increased risk of peritonitis (P = 0.035 and P = 0.029, respectively). In elderly patients (≥65 years old), the rate of peritonitis due to Gram‐positive and Gram‐negative bacteria was 0.17 and 0.08 episodes/patient‐year, respectively, and Gram‐positive peritonitis was markedly more frequent than in younger patients (<65 years old). In particular, there was a high frequency of Staphylococcus aureus peritonitis in elderly patients (0.09 episodes/patient‐year) and it had a poor outcome. At our department, the risk of peritonitis was increased in older patients and patients with hypoalbuminemia. The distribution of causative organisms was markedly different between age groups and analysis of organism‐specific peritonitis rates helped to identify current problems with our PD program.  相似文献

Chronic malnutrition is a common problem in patients with end‐stage renal disease on hemodialysis. Some studies have reported albumin loss into dialysis fluid during postdilution online hemodiafiltration (OL‐HDF). The aim of the study was to assess the nutritional status of patients on high‐volume OL‐HDF and to demonstrate that higher convective clearances are not associated with malnutrition due to possible loss of nutrients with ultrafiltration. Demographic and clinical data, corporal composition with bioimpedance spectroscopy, dialysis features, albumin loss into dialysis fluid and laboratory parameters were collected in twenty‐eight patients with ESRD undergoing postdilution OL‐HDF with stable convective volumes over 28 L/session. Convective volume (CV) in the last six months was 32.51 ± 3.52 L per session. Cross‐sectional analysis of dialysis features showed 32.7 ± 3.34 L of CV and high reduction rates of beta‐2‐microglobulin (84.2 ± 3.8%) and cystatin‐C (81.6 ± 3.47%). Beta‐2‐microglobulin reduction showed a positive correlation with prealbumin levels (P = 0.048). CV was only correlated with cystatin‐C reduction (P = 0.025). Estimated albumin loss into dialysis fluid (1.82 ± 1.05 g/session) was not related to laboratory or bioimpedance nutritional parameters, or to CV. Among patients with higher CV, serum albumin levels maintained more stability during the observational period. High volume OL‐HDF results in better convective clearances and is not associated with malnutrition. Albumin and nutrients loss into dialysis fluid should not be a limiting factor of the substitution volume.  相似文献

Hypertension, non‐dipper blood pressure (BP) pattern and decrease in daily urine output have been associated with left ventricular hypertrophy (LVH) in peritoneal dialysis (PD) patients. However, there is lack of data regarding the impact of different PD regimens on these factors. We aimed to investigate the impact of circadian rhythm of BP on LVH in end‐stage renal disease patients using automated peritoneal dialysis (APD) or continuous ambulatory peritoneal dialysis (CAPD) modalities. Twenty APD (7 men, 13 women) and 28 CAPD (16 men, 12 women) patients were included into the study. 24‐h ambulatory blood pressure monitoring (ABPM) and transthoracic echocardiography besides routine blood examinations were performed. Two groups were compared with each other for ABPM measurements, BP loads, dipping patterns, left ventricular mass index (LVMI) and daily urine output. Mean systolic and diastolic BP measurements, BP loads, LVMI, residual renal function (RRF) and percentage of non‐dippers were found to be similar for the two groups. There were positive correlations of LVMI with BP measurements and BP loads. LVMI was found to be significantly higher in diastolic non‐dippers compared to dippers (140.4 ± 35.3 vs 114.5 ± 29.7, respectively, P = 0.02). RRF and BP were found to be independent predictors of LVMI. Non‐dipping BP pattern was a frequent finding among all PD patients without an inter‐group difference. Additionally, higher BP measurements, decrease in daily urine output and non‐dipper diastolic BP pattern were associated with LVMI. In order to avoid LVH, besides correction of anemia and volume control, circadian BP variability and diastolic dipping should also be taken into consideration in PD patients.  相似文献

Atherosclerosis is frequently present in patients with chronic kidney disease (CKD) treated with dialysis. We evaluated the association between residual renal function (RRF), phosphate level, inflammation and other risk factors in carotid modeling as a marker of early atherosclerosis in peritoneal dialysis (PD) compared with hemodialysis (HD) patients. We studied 39 stable PD and 53 HD patients on renal replacement therapy (RRT) for 3 to 36 months duration. B‐mode ultrasonography was used to determine carotid artery intima media thickness (CIMT). We classified patients with atherosclerosis if they have CIMT >10 mm and or presence of plaque. Out of our total dialysis population studied of 92 patients, 16.3% were diabetics and 57.6% were on hemodialysis. Expectedly, PD patients had a higher RRF (P < 0.001), 24 h urine volume (P < 0.001); C‐reactive protein (P = 0.047), and a lower serum phosphate (P = 0.01), PTH (P < 0.05), alkaline phosphatase (P < 0.05), and albumin levels (P < 0.001) compared to hemodialysis patients. Atherosclerosis was found in 66.3% of patients and in 100% of a diabetic population. There was no significant difference in the presence of atherosclerosis between PD and HD patients [56.4 vs 73.6% HD, respectively]. Multiple regression analysis showed age, diabetes, HD modality, RRF, phosphate, PTH and pulse pressure as independent parameters associated with atherosclerosis. Apart from the traditional risk factors like age and diabetes, our study showed a link of atherosclerosis with metabolic abnormalities secondary to renal failure. We demonstrated a novel, independent association between RRF and atherosclerosis, underlining the importance of preservation of the RRF in dialysis patients.  相似文献

Fibroblast growth factor 23 (FGF23) levels in dialysis patients are influenced by various factors, including phosphorus load. However, the clinical parameters that determine serum FGF23 levels in patients on peritoneal dialysis (PD) remain unclear. The aim of the present study was to examine the effects of clinical factors, on serum FGF23 levels, with an emphasis on residual renal function (RRF). This cross‐sectional study included 56 outpatients undergoing PD therapy. Urine volume ≥100 mL/day or renal creatinine (Cr) clearance was used as a surrogate marker for RRF. Clinical characteristics were compared between patients with and without RRF. Linear regression analysis was conducted with serum FGF23 level as the dependent variable and renal Cr clearance as the main independent variable. The median and interquartile range of serum FGF23 levels were 5970 (1451–11 688) pg/mL. Patients with RRF showed higher urinary and total phosphate eliminations, and lower serum FGF23 and phosphate levels than patients without RRF. Multivariate linear regression analysis showed that the renal Cr clearance and serum phosphate and dialysis history were negatively associated with serum FGF23 levels, even after adjusting for potential confounders including peritoneal Cr clearance. Further, the predictabilities of serum FGF23 were comparable among renal Cr clearance, Kt/V for urea, and renal phosphate clearance. RRF determined by renal Cr clearance or residual urine volume is an independent negative determinant of serum FGF23 levels in PD patients.  相似文献

Selenium deficiency has been implicated as contributing to the development of cardiovascular disease, skeletal muscle myopathy, anemia, increased cancer risk, and deranged immune function. Since these problems may also be associated with renal failure, and the kidney plays an important role in selenium homeostasis, we measured selenium and compared it with nutritional status in 24 stable hemodialysis patients, 12 chronic intermittent peritoneal dialysis patients, and 29 healthy controls. Whole blood and plasma selenium was determined by a spectrofluorometric method. For whole blood the mean (+/- SD) selenium levels were 0.11 +/- 0.02 micrograms/ml in controls vs. 0.071 +/- 0.01 micrograms/ml in hemodialysis cases and 0.052 +/- 0.006 micrograms/ml in peritoneal dialysis (p less than 0.005). Significant decreases were seen also for plasma and red blood cell selenium in all groups respectively. Pre- and postdialysis plasma and whole blood selenium levels showed no significant changes in both dialysis groups. However, predialysis residual peritoneal fluid did contain selenium (0.029 +/- 0.005 micrograms/ml). Some evidence of protein-energy undernutrition was noted in both dialysis groups compared with controls. However, no significant differences in nutritional parameters were noted between hemodialysis and peritoneal dialysis patients. When all groups were combined, significant correlations were found between whole blood selenium and serum albumin (r = 0.61; p less than 0.001), triceps skin fold in females (r = 0.62; p less than 0.001), and midarm muscle circumference in males (r = 0.71; p less than 0.001). We conclude that low blood selenium is present in renal failure patients undergoing hemodialysis. Nephrotic syndrome is a condition commonly associated with end-stage renal disease secondary to diabetic nephropathy. It is usually associated with long-standing renal insufficiency, microalbuminuria, and overt proteinuria. We present a diabetic patient with acute oliguric renal failure and nephrotic syndrome. At presentation, he had a serum creatinine of 2.3 mg/dl, blood urea nitrogen (BUN) of 69 mg/dl, urinary protein excretion of 10.5 g/24 h, serum albumin of 1.3 g/dl, and a urine output < 400 cc/24 h. A renal biopsy was done and the renal pathology was compatible with early diabetic nephropathy. Despite intense diuretic therapy, the patient's renal condition did not improve, and peritoneal dialysis was started several months after diagnosis. After 8 months of dialysis therapy, the patient's renal parameters and urinary output spontaneously restored to normal limits (serum creatinine was 1.1 mg/dl, urinary albumin excretion was 411 mg/24 h, serum albumin was 4.3 g/dl, and normal urine output) and dialysis was discontinued. His renal function did not deteriorate after discontinuation of dialysis. We conclude that this patient's reversible acute renal failure and nephrotic syndrome were associated with minimal change disease and not due to diabetic nephropathy.  相似文献

Combination therapy with peritoneal dialysis and hemodialysis (PD+HD) is widely used in Japan for PD patients with decreased residual renal function. However, fluid status in PD+HD patients has not been well studied. In this cross‐sectional study, we compared fluid status in 41 PD+HD patients with that in 103 HD and 92 PD patients using the bioimpedance spectroscopy. Extracellular water normalized to patient height (NECW, kg/m) was the highest in pre‐HD (8.3 ± 1.6) followed by PD (7.9 ± 2.7), PD+HD (7.5 ± 2.5), and post‐HD patients (6.9 ± 1.5) (P < 0.01). By multiple linear regression analysis, PD+HD was associated with a significantly lower NECW than pre‐HD (β = ?0.8, P = 0.03) and similar to PD (β = ?0.5, P = 0.24) and post‐HD (β = 0.6, P = 0.08) after adjustment for age, sex, diabetic nephropathy, ischemic heart disease, dialysis period, and daily urine volume. There was no correlation between NECW and daily urine volume in all dialysis groups. Average daily fluid removal (a sum of urine volume and ultrafiltration volume by dialysis) was positively correlated with NECW in PD+HD and pre‐HD, but not in PD and post‐HD patients. Our results suggest that fluid status in PD+HD patients with decreased residual renal function is acceptable as compared with that in HD and PD patients.  相似文献

ABSTRACT: BACKGROUND: Chronic kidney disease (CKD) with edema is a common clinical problem resulting from defects in water and solute excretion. Furosemide is the drug of choice for treatment. In theory, good perfusion and albumin are required for the furosemide to be secreted at the tubular lumen. Thus, in the situation of low glomerular filtration rate (GFR) and hypoalbuminemia, the efficacy of furosemide alone might be limited. There has been no study to validate the effectiveness of the combination of furosemide and albumin in this condition. METHODS: We conducted a randomized controlled crossover study to compare the efficacy of diuretics between furosemide alone and the combination of furosemide plus albumin in stable hypoalbuminemic CKD patients by measuring urine output and sodium. The baseline urine output/sodium at 6 and 24 hours were recorded. The increment of urine output/sodium after treatment at 6 and 24 hours were calculated by using post-treatment minus baseline urine output/sodium at the corresponding period. RESULTS: Twenty-four CKD patients (GFR = 31.0 [PLUS-MINUS SIGN] 13.8 mL/min) with hypoalbuminemia (2.98 [PLUS-MINUS SIGN] 0.30 g/dL) were enrolled. At 6 hours, there were significant differences in the increment of urine volume (0.47 [PLUS-MINUS SIGN] 0.40 vs 0.67 [PLUS-MINUS SIGN] 0.31 L, P < 0.02) and urine sodium (37.5 [PLUS-MINUS SIGN] 29.3 vs 55.0 [PLUS-MINUS SIGN] 26.7 mEq, P < 0.01) between treatment with furosemide alone and with furosemide plus albumin. However, at 24 hours, there were no significant differences in the increment of urine volume (0.49 [PLUS-MINUS SIGN] 0.47 vs 0.59 [PLUS-MINUS SIGN] 0.50 L, P = 0.46) and urine sodium (65.3 [PLUS-MINUS SIGN] 47.5 vs 76.1 [PLUS-MINUS SIGN] 50.1 mEq, P = 0.32) between the two groups. CONCLUSION: The combination of furosemide and albumin has a superior short-term efficacy over furosemide alone in enhancing water and sodium diuresis in hypoalbuminemic CKD patients.Trial registrationThe Australian New Zealand Clinical Trials Registration (ANZCTR12611000480987).  相似文献

慢性肾功能衰竭及透析患者营养状况的评价   总被引:29,自引:0,他引:29  
为了提高尿毒症患者的生活质量,为进行营养治疗提供科学依据,采用多种方法对40例尿毒症非透析及透析患者进行营养评价。食谱调查显示:每日摄入动物蛋白占总蛋白的比率,在血透组、腹透组均明显高于尿毒症非透析组(P<0.01,P<0.05);透析患者每日摄入蛋白量和热量均低于推荐摄入量。人体测量显示:35%透析患者肌肉蛋白储量减少,而尿毒症非透析组则有80%减少。血浆白蛋白测定血透组明显高于腹透组(P<0.01);血透组50%,腹透组80%及尿毒症非透析组60%的患者白蛋白低于正常。用尿素氮生成率评价血透、腹透患者的营养状态,65%血透患者及37.5%腹透患者为负氮平衡。综合评价表明58%透析患者有不同程度的营养不良。  相似文献

The purpose of the study was to pilot a nurse‐performed nutritional screening tool (NST) for dialysis patients in order to identify nutritionally at‐risk patients. Haemodialysis (HD) patients are at risk of nutritional‐related problems. Nutritional screening by nurses may assist in the early recognition of and response to these problems. An NST was developed using 9 screening parameters. (BMI, weight change, poor appetite, GI symptoms, albumin, pre‐dialysis urea, K+, PO4++, HbA1c). The NST was compared with Standard Dietitian Assessment (SDA). 44 HD patients were screened with the NST and then with SDA. The tool showed sensitivity of 0.7 (95%Cl+/‐0.21) and a specificity of 0.77 (95%Cl+/‐0.16). Reliability was low (alpha =.18). Alpha increased to 0.32 if pre‐dialysis urea was removed from the tool and increased to 0.48 if weight loss, appetite, K+ and PO4++ were used alone. The pilot study showed a low reliability of the NST compared with SDA. With further analysis and modifications, the NST has the potential to assist nutritional screening by nurses in dialysis centres that have limited dietetic access.  相似文献

The aim of this study was to quantify the effect of different mortality risk factors in peritoneal dialysis and to establish a prognostic index that could predict mortality risk when patients start dialysis. A prospective study was performed on 103 patients included in our peritoneal dialysis program. The mean follow-up time was 26 +/- 21 months. A multivariate analysis (Cox regression was made to identify different risk factors that could influence patient survival during peritoneal dialysis. Age, gender, parathyroid hormone, albumin, cholesterol, and the presence of diabetes mellitus were evaluated as potential risk factors. Patients were distributed in three groups (high, medium and low risk), according to the risk factors with a significant influence in multivariate analysis, and patient survival was studied depending on the prognostic index using Kaplan-Meier estimator. Overall patient survival was 90% (95%CI: 83 to 96%) after the first year and 40% (95%IC: 32 to 58%) after 5 years of follow-up. The Cox regression analysis identified albumin below 4 g/dL (RR: 2.57; 95% CI: 1.16 to 5.72), age older than 65 years RR: 3.10; 95%IC: 1.20 to 7.98) and diabetes mellitus (relative risk, RR: 4.36; 95%IC: 1.43 to 13.31) as independent risk factors for mortality in patients receiving peritoneal dialysis. Patient survival after two years was 40% (95%IC: 31 to 59%), 73% (95%IC: 60 a 86%) and 100% (p < 0.05), respectively. Malnutrition and related factors in patients receiving peritoneal dialysis are associated with a higher mortality rate.  相似文献

Chronic systemic inflammation, a non traditional risk factor of cardiovascular diseases, is associated with increasing mortality in chronic kidney disease, especially peritoneal dialysis patients. Periodontitis is a potential treatable source of systemic inflammation in peritoneal dialysis patients. Clinical periodontal status was evaluated in 32 stable chronic peritoneal dialysis patients by plaque index and periodontal disease index. Hematologic, blood chemical, nutritional, and dialysis‐related data as well as highly sensitive C‐reactive protein were analyzed before and after periodontal treatment. At baseline, high sensitive C‐reactive protein positively correlated with the clinical periodontal status (plaque index; r = 0.57, P < 0.01, periodontal disease index; r = 0.56, P < 0.01). After completion of periodontal therapy, clinical periodontal indexes were significantly lower and high sensitivity C‐reactive protein significantly decreased from 2.93 to 2.21 mg/L. Moreover, blood urea nitrogen increased from 47.33 to 51.8 mg/dL, reflecting nutritional status improvement. Erythropoietin dosage requirement decreased from 8000 to 6000 units/week while hemoglobin level was stable. Periodontitis is an important source of chronic systemic inflammation in peritoneal dialysis patients. Treatment of periodontal diseases can improve systemic inflammation, nutritional status and erythropoietin responsiveness in peritoneal dialysis patients.  相似文献

血透与腹透患者血清脂蛋白(a)的变化及意义   总被引:10,自引:1,他引:9  
目的观察血透(HD)与腹透(PD)患者之间脂蛋白(a)[lipoprotein(a),Lp(a)]及脂质水平影响的差别及其临床意义.方法对68例HD患者及50例PD患者的临床及实验室资料作研究,比较两种透析方式对血Lp(a)及脂质水平影响的差别,分析血Lp(a)与其他相关因素特别是与心脑血管事件的关系.结果HD与PD患者血Lp(a)水平均较对照组呈显著性升高(P<0.05),其中PD组较HD组更高(P<0.01);HD组血Tch较对照组及PD组均呈显著性下降(P<0.05)、血HDL-C较对照组呈显著性下降(P<0.01);PD组血TG较对照组及HD组均呈显著性升高(P<0.05);血ApoA、ApoB100与对照组间无统计学差异.HD与PD患者血Lp(a)水平与超声心动图异常(P<0.05)、ECG异常(P<0.001)及心脑血管事件的发生(P<0.01)、24h腹水蛋白质浓度(P<0.01)、血Tch及LDL-C浓度(P<0.05)、纤维蛋白原(P<0.05)呈正相关;而与血浆白蛋白浓度(P<0.05)、24h腹水Lp(a)浓度(P<0.05)呈负相关.结论HD与PD患者普遍存在严重的脂质代谢变化,其中以血Lp(a)、TG、HDL-C变化尤为显著,PD组由于长期吸收大量葡萄糖,因此脂质代谢紊乱更为明显.Lp(a)有可能是HD、PD患者并发心脑血管事件的危险因素之一.  相似文献

The relation of various demographic, clinical and biochemical parameters of peritoneal dialysis patients with peritonitis and other infections was evaluated. The age, gender, peritoneal dialysis (PD) period, educational status, peritonitis, exit site score, serum albumin, C-reactive protein (CRP), and triglyceride levels at the beginning and the last visit were recorded. Mean age of 32 patients was 45.1 years; PD period was 13.1 months. Albumin level was inversely proportional to the frequency of peritonitis. Patients with peritonitis had albumin levels that were lower at the last visit, and were independent of the CRP values at the start of PD and during follow-up. Significant correlation was detected between females and exit site scores. There was significant correlation between educational status and peritonitis. Albumin level at first visit was a factor that reduced the likelihood of peritonitis, and low levels obtained during follow-up constituted a risk for peritonitis. It was also shown that peritonitis risk tended to decrease inversely with education level.  相似文献

Aim: A multicenter prospective intervention study was conducted in 204 patients with uncompensated liver cirrhosis to explore the influence of dietary intake and patient clinical characteristics on improvement of hypoalbuminemia at weeks 12 and 24 of treatment with branched-chain amino acid (BCAA) granules. Methods: The primary endpoint set in this study was improvement of hypoalbuminemia in patients with liver cirrhosis. The dietary energy and protein intake per day were estimated based on the results of a survey on diet during a 3-day period preceding the start of the study. Results: As for the primary endpoint, the mean serum albumin level increased significantly at weeks 12 and 24 of BCAA treatment, compared with the baseline level. The mean Child-Pugh score decreased significantly at weeks 12 and 24 of treatment as compared to the mean baseline score. There was a significant increase in the serum albumin level following treatment with BCAA granules regardless of energy intake and of protein intake. The incidence of ascites and edema significantly decreased in the overall patient population both at weeks 12 and 24 of treatment, compared with the baseline incidence. A subgroup analysis conducted in patients stratified according to changes in the serum albumin level at week 12 of treatment as against baseline showed that the incidence of ascites/edema was significantly reduced not only in the increased albumin group but in the unchanged albumin group. Conclusion: The present data suggest that the anti-hypoalbuminemic effect of BCAA treatment in patients with liver cirrhosis is independent of dietary intake.  相似文献

目的分析老年连续性非卧床腹膜透析患者的临床资料,探讨老年腹透患者发生腹透相关性腹膜炎的影响因素。方法回顾性分析上海市第一人民医院松江分院肾内科自2003年1月至2009年5月行连续性非卧床腹膜透析患者70例,分为两组:A组年龄≥60岁,48例,B组年龄〈60岁,22例;比较两组的平均年龄、平均腹透龄、文化程度、血浆白蛋白、札红蛋白、腹膜炎的致病菌及合并其他脏器感染、合并心衰并发症的病例数;比较两组的平均住院日、死亡率、分析腹膜炎发生的影响因素。结果A组老年组文化水平偏低(P〈0.01),血浆白蛋白及血红蛋白较低,腹透龄较B组缩短,但无统计学意义。A组腹膜炎的发生率明显增加,致病菌组成无差异,并发感染、心哀较多,死产病例增加,且有统计学意义(P〈0.05)。结论老年连续性非卧床腹膜透析患者腹膜炎的发生率高,合并症多,致平均住院日延长,死产病例增加。  相似文献
